Judicial Ethics Opinion 20-210

Where a law firm's managing partner is the sibling of a New York State judge, a Surrogate's Court judge in a county specified in Section 36.1(a)(11) may not appoint any attorney of the law firm to serve as the Public Administrator, nor may the Surrogate appoint the law firm as counsel to the Public Administrator.

Judicial Ethics Opinion 20-209

A full-time judge may not be a member of a bar association task force organized to monitor and discuss fiscal and human rights issues faced by residents of a United States territory.
